Stick to Dragon Age: The Veilguard, Because ‘This Year Will be Quieter’ for Mass Effect N7 Day

N7 Day, which rightfully takes place on November 7th of each year, is Mass Effect‘s holiday and where fans often expect big announcements for the franchise. Mass Effect 5 is the next expectation, now that The Veilguard has concluded Dragon Age. However, BioWare wants you to focus on Dragon Age for now, because it appears it has nothing exciting in store for Mass Effect this upcoming N7 Day.

The statement and lots of other implications came from a tweet from BioWare’s official X/Twitter account.

We hope everyone is enjoying their time in #DragonAge: The Veilguard. Itโ€™s only a few days until #N7Day and this year will be quieter because of launch. Be sure to check back then for a little fun, though!

— BioWare (@bioware) November 4, 2024

It’s like they’re already expecting your expectations and would like for you to tone it down. Granted, 2024 has only two months left so ‘this year’ doesn’t exactly have a significant timetable left for announcements. Still, some fans are worried about Mass Effect‘s future.

After all, some of them expected that BioWare would quell the recent Dragon Age: The Veilguard controversy with some glowing and reassuring reveals for Mass Effect (its sci-fi counterpart). Dragon Age: The Veilguard notably drew criticism due to how it abruptly shifted away from the series’ dark fantasy roots.

Even BioWare’s Executive Producer, Michael Gamble had to chime in and reassure fans that Mass Effect will remain mature and dark. Sadly, fan anxiety has been renewed following BioWare’s N7 announcement.

Mass Effect 5 is Coming Along

The only development news about Mass Effect 5 at the moment is that it’s under development. It also has some of the series veterans working on it, thankfully. Moreover, BioWare also recently announced that Dragon Age: The Veilguard is done. The Dragon Age sequel won’t be getting any DLCs so that their teams can focus on Mass Effect.

It’s worth noting that 2023’s N7 Day had new information about Mass Effect and even included a 34-second teaser trailer for Mass Effect 5.

To be fair, that’s quite hard to top, and BioWare would have to reveal considerably more for 2024’s N7 Day. Too bad they won’t. Not this year.
